When we got started we had little experience with farming, just a few pieces of equipment and no idea that the apple orchard would become such an important part of their spruce tree operation. Donna, Leon, & Lee Nesbitt started the Nursery in 1995, and in the spring of 1996 the whole family got together to plant the first spruce and apple trees; 8,500 Colorado Blue and Black Hills spruce and 100 apple trees. From the original three varieties of apples that Lee and Leah planted in 1996, we have grown to incorporate a wide range of different apple varieties and products. In 2005 they opened a retail space in which they provide locally produced and sourced products. In addition to the multitude of their own Food Alliance Certified apples, produce and fresh pressed cider, they offer syrup, honey (harvested from their backyard) fair-trade & organic coffee, homemade ice cream, local art and music, and now we offer breakfast, lunch and pastries in our eatery, Oasis Eatery.     Nesbitt's serves & prepares local products which include select breakfast/lunch/pastries! We offer WI artisan cheese, syrup, & honey, which is harvested from Nesbitt's back yard! We offer a green house/garden center in the spring/summer, a CSA program in the summer/fall. We sell Colorado/Black Hill spruce trees for landscape, seasonal rural experiences in the fall & are the home of Happ-E-Hill Pumpkin Farm! We sell apples, squash, pumpkins and have a nature center where we press fresh cider!
